" Actually, the turn of the century did not mark the beginning of political regulation of conveyances. Local and municipal governments were already regulating and licensing bicycle usage within their jurisdictions during the 1880s and 1890s. (Mason 42) For example, the city of Chicago had a "Wheel Tax" ordinance in effect in 1898, which required an annual license fee from all wagons, carriages, coaches, buggies, and bicycles"

Although we "subjects of the crown" in the UK we can. Collect rain water, fish (sea fishing is fine but you need the permission of the person who owns the fishing rights elsewhere), start a business, renovate your home (up to extensions or loft conversions), hunt (again with the land owners permission but you cannot use dogs unless they are gun dogs). cut hair, sell a product, grow food on your property and we are one of the few countries where you can sail a boat without a licence. Oh and PS you do not need the govt permission to ride a bike or horse still just like 125 years ago.
